Let say we want to record a song which is 80 measure long. And you record 4 songs of 20 measures each. How can we join to make it as a one song.
Or let say we need to record a song of 80 measures
First 10 measure intro
11 to 30 verse 1
31 to 40 Interlude
41 to 60 verse 2
Verse 1 and 2 are same music so I don't want to play the keyboard from measure 1 to 80 at a stretch. I want to play from from 11 to 30 and copy paste it to measure 41.
I know how to do it in FL Studio. But the joined midi file is not playing properly on keyboard. It just plays the notes with piano sound in all track.
Then I may have an option to assign sound for each track. But all these take a lot of time.
I remember Yamaha keyboard had an option to punch in. Something like that is there?
Copy paste measures in keyboard is the best option if available. _________________ Bny |
